The Core Pillars of Spinal Safety
To choose a bag that truly protects, you must focus on three fundamental pillars that differentiate a standard sack from an orthopedic powerhouse:
- Lumbar Alignment: Your choice must use contoured back panels, firm padding, or 'S-curve' structures that mirror the natural shape of the spine. Flat, unpadded backs signal a lack of design maturity.
- Load Stabilization: Weight shouldn't swing in a vacuum. Each bag must be equipped with backpack chest straps and hip belts. Instead of just hanging from the shoulders, these distribute the load across the stronger core muscles.
- Anatomic Contouring: The path from putting the bag on to walking to school should be as comfortable as possible. This requires wide, padded shoulder straps that eliminate digging and nerve compression.

The Structural Framework of an Effective Bag
When selecting a bag, the underlying structure is as important as the external fabric. Utilizing smart organization ensures that physics works in your favor. Using internal compartments to keep heavy books close to the back—within the 10-15% of body weight rule—helps the spine maintain a neutral position rather than being pulled backward by leverage.

Measuring the Success of Your Choice
Unlike traditional school supplies where 'Durability' is the primary metric, an ergonomic school bag requires more granular health KPIs. You should be observing:
- Posture Retention: Is the student walking upright, or are they hunching forward to compensate for the weight?
- Pain Signals: How frequently does the child complain of neck or shoulder strain after a long school day?
- Energy Levels: The difference in fatigue levels when a child uses a properly fitted bag versus a standard one.
